html5网页

导读 HTML5是一种用于创建网页的标准标记语言版本。它引入了许多新的功能和元素,使网页开发更加灵活和强大。以下是关于HTML5网页的一些基本概念...

HTML5是一种用于创建网页的标准标记语言版本。它引入了许多新的功能和元素,使网页开发更加灵活和强大。以下是关于HTML5网页的一些基本概念和特性:

1. 结构化语义元素:HTML5引入了更多的结构化语义元素,如`

`、`
`、`
`、`
`等,这些元素有助于描述网页内容的结构和意义,提高网页的可读性和可访问性。

2. 音视频支持:HTML5内置了对音频和视频的支持,通过`

3. 画布(Canvas)和SVG图形:HTML5提供了``元素和SVG(可缩放矢量图形)技术,允许在网页上绘制图形和动画。这些技术广泛应用于游戏开发、图形应用和数据可视化等领域。

4. 地理位置API:HTML5引入了地理位置API,允许网页获取用户的地理位置信息。这对于开发地图应用、位置服务和基于位置的内容等功能非常有用。

5. 存储和离线功能:HTML5引入了Web存储(Web Storage)技术,包括本地存储(LocalStorage)和会话存储(SessionStorage),可以存储用户的数据和应用程序的状态。此外,HTML5还提供了离线功能,使网页应用程序可以在没有网络连接的情况下运行。

6. 表单元素和输入类型:HTML5增强了对表单的支持,引入了一些新的表单元素和输入类型,如日期选择器、颜色选择器、滑块等。这些元素提高了表单的交互性和用户体验。

7. 媒体查询(Media Queries):HTML5与CSS3结合使用媒体查询,可以根据设备的特性(如屏幕尺寸、方向、分辨率等)来应用不同的样式。这使得响应式网页设计成为可能,可以适应不同的设备和屏幕尺寸。

要创建一个HTML5网页,你需要编写HTML代码来定义网页的结构和内容。你可以使用文本编辑器或集成开发环境(IDE)来编写HTML代码,然后将代码保存为以`.html`为扩展名的文件。在浏览器中打开该文件,你将看到由HTML代码生成的网页。

除了HTML代码本身,你还需要了解CSS(层叠样式表)和JavaScript来增强网页的样式和交互性。CSS用于定义网页的外观和布局,而JavaScript用于添加动态效果和交互功能。

总的来说,HTML5为网页开发提供了许多强大的功能和灵活性,使得创建富有交互性和动态效果的网页变得更加容易。

版权声明:本文由用户上传,如有侵权请联系删除!